Is Troy School District school of choice?
The Troy School District Board of Education has voted to accept a “Limited” Schools of Choice program for the 2022-2023 school year for both 105 (in Oakland County) and 105c (outside Oakland County living in a county contiguous to Oakland County).

Are Troy Michigan schools good?
Troy School District is a top rated, public school district located in TROY, MI. It has 13,140 students in grades PK, K-12 with a student-teacher ratio of 17 to 1. According to state test scores, 71% of students are at least proficient in math and 77% in reading.

How are Lake Orion schools?
Lake Orion Community Schools is a highly rated, public school district located in LAKE ORION, MI. It has 7,244 students in grades PK, K-12 with a student-teacher ratio of 17 to 1. According to state test scores, 59% of students are at least proficient in math and 74% in reading.
